Qā’emīyeh in Winter

In winter (December, January and February), Qā’emīyeh sees average daytime highs around 16°C and overnight lows near 4°C, with 331 mm of rain over about 25 wet days across the season. It is the coldest season of the year and the wettest season of the year.

Across winter, daytime highs hold fairly steady around 16°C.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 56% of the time across winter, and the air most often feels dry.

Location & terrain

Where is Qā’emīyeh?

Qā’emīyeh sits at 29.9°N, 51.6°E, 880 m above sea level, in Iran. The nearest listed city is Kāzerūn, 27 km away.

Topography around Qā’emīyeh

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Qā’emīyeh.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Qā’emīyeh has large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 631 m around an average of 940 m above sea level; within 16 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 2,110 m; within 80 km, extreme vari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 3,691 m.

The land around Qā’emīyeh is covered by grassland (40%) and cropland (24%) within 3 km, grassland (74%) within 16 km, and grassland (63%) within 80 km.
